Suggested Use & Instructions: Use as a treat, snack, or training tool. Feed whole or break into smaller pieces.

Ingredients: Ground duck hearts.

Calorie Content (ME, Calculated): 4930 kcal/kg   140 kcal/oz

ga-duckheartround-01.jpg

Additional Information: No refrigeration necessary. Product is freeze-dried. Not for human consumption.
